How Script-to-Video AI Works in 2026
A script-to-video tool runs a pipeline over your text: it segments the script into scenes, generates or matches a visual for each segment, synthesizes a voiceover, time-syncs captions word by word, and assembles everything into an exportable vertical video. You supply judgment at two points, the script itself, and the review pass before export.
Two families of tools answer "what AI can create videos from text descriptions," and confusing them wastes money:
Script-to-video platforms (the subject of this guide) turn a narrative into a finished short, voiceover, captions, visuals, structure. Their visuals come from AI image generation, template graphics, or licensed footage.
Text-to-video models (Sora-class, Pika, Luma) turn a prompt into raw cinematic footage, no voice, no captions, no story structure. They're a visual ingredient, not a video factory.
For faceless Shorts, you want the first family, optionally fed by the second. Everything below assumes that setup.

Step 1–Step 8: From Script to Published Short

Step 1: Write or adapt your script for the ear, not the eye. Short sentences, present tense, one idea per line. A 60-second Short holds roughly 130–160 spoken words, write to that budget from the start and you'll never fight the edit later.
Step 2: Paste your script, or upload a transcript. Every serious tool accepts pasted text; transcript upload matters when you're repurposing a podcast or long video into shorts. One rule: never feed a raw transcript straight through. Cut filler, tighten the opening line, and give it a hook, a transcript is source material, not a script.
Step 3: Choose your visual style per scene. AI-generated imagery for story formats, template graphics for rankings and text conversations, licensed footage for realism. Pick one visual language per channel (more on why in the consistency section) and let the tool auto-assign scenes before you fine-tune the two or three that miss.
Step 4: Generate the voiceover. Voice choice moves retention more than any visual decision. Match energy to format, calm and low for scary stories, bright and quick for rankings, and preview two or three voices on your actual opening line, not the tool's demo text. If you'll publish daily, set up a custom cloned voice once and make it your channel's audio signature.
Step 5: Generate and check captions. Word-synced captions are non-negotiable, most Shorts are watched with sound off at first. Auto-captioning is near-perfect on clean AI voiceover, but proofread names, brands, and numbers; a misspelled caption reads as low-effort to viewers and to platforms scoring originality.
Step 6: Apply your branding. Consistent caption font and color, a fixed logo corner, and your channel's visual motif. Thirty seconds per video; compounding recognition across hundreds.
Step 7: Review at full speed, then export. Watch once at normal speed as a viewer, not a producer: does the hook land in two seconds, does any scene lag, does the CTA fit the story? Fix, then export vertical 9:16 at 1080p.
Step 8: Publish with intent. Title and first caption line carry your keyword, pinned comment carries your link (affiliate or channel), and posting time matches your audience's timezone. Then log the video in your tracking sheet, what you measure in Step 8 becomes your Step 1 judgment next week.

How Long Does AI Video Generation Actually Take? Real Timings per Step
Honest 2026 timings for one 60-second faceless Short, once you know your tool:
Scripting: 10–15 minutes writing fresh; 5–10 adapting a source story
Generation (voice + visuals + captions): typically 2–10 minutes of processing depending on tool and visual style, AI-image-heavy scenes render slower than template graphics
Review and fixes: 5–10 minutes, usually swapping one or two visuals and correcting a caption
Packaging and publishing: 3–5 minutes
Realistic total: 20–35 minutes per video as a beginner, dropping to 10–15 minutes with templates and batching. Marketing claims of "a video in 3 minutes" describe the processing step, not the workflow, the machine time is real, but the judgment time is what makes the video worth publishing. Budget for both and your content calendar will survive contact with reality.

Writing Scripts and Prompts That Generate Better Videos
The quality ceiling of an AI video is set before generation starts. Five rules that measurably improve output:
Rule #1: Front-load the hook. Your first line is your retention graph. Open with the tension, question, or claim, "My landlord texted me at 3am", never with context. Context earns its place after attention exists.
Rule #2: Write in scene-sized beats. One sentence, one visual. Long compound sentences force the tool to hold one image too long, the visual version of a wall of text.
Rule #3: Be concrete in visual prompts. "A dimly lit 1950s diner, rain on the window, one empty booth" generates something usable; "sad diner scene" generates mush. Nouns and lighting beat adjectives.
Rule #4: Keep a prompt style block. A saved sentence describing your channel's look, art style, palette, mood, pasted into every image prompt. This one habit is most of what separates coherent channels from random-generator channels.
Rule #5: End with a beat, not a fade. Script a final line that lands, a twist, a question, a payoff, because the last two seconds decide whether viewers swipe to your next video or away from your channel.

How to Keep AI Videos Consistent Across a Channel: Style, Voice, and Branding
Consistency is the difference between "a channel" and "a feed of AI clips," and it's built from four locked decisions:
One voice. The same AI voice, ideally a custom clone, on every video. Viewers recognize audio identity faster than visual identity; changing voices resets the relationship to zero
One visual language. Same art style, same palette, same caption treatment. Save it as a reusable template and your prompt style block (Rule #4 above) enforces it at generation time
One structural rhythm. Same hook pattern, similar pacing, familiar ending beat. Formats are promises; consistency is keeping them
Branding as a system, not a decision. Logo position, fonts, and colors set once in a template, never re-decided per video, never drifting
The compounding effect is real: consistent channels train binge behavior (viewers watch three, not one), and per-video production gets faster because every aesthetic decision is pre-made.
Advanced Polish: Pacing, Motion, and Cinematic Feel
Once fundamentals are habitual, three upgrades separate your output from default AI look:
Cut faster than feels natural. Top-performing shorts change visuals every 2–4 seconds. If a scene sits longer than a sentence, split it into two images or add movement
Use motion deliberately. Slow zooms and pans on still AI images (the "Ken Burns" treatment) add life cheaply; save real camera-movement clips, AI-generated dolly or aerial shots, for your hook and climax, where they earn their render cost
Design your audio layer. A quiet music bed under narration, one sound effect on the twist, and a beat of silence before the payoff, audio contrast is the cheapest cinematic tool that AI defaults ignore
The test for "cinematic enough": mute the video. If the visual rhythm alone holds attention for 15 seconds, the polish is working.

Replacing Stock Footage with AI-Generated B-Roll
Stock footage is the reason most faceless channels look identical, the same handshake clip appears on a thousand channels. AI-generated B-roll fixes ownership and sameness at once:
Generate scene-specific images or clips for each beat instead of keyword-matching a stock library, your 1950s diner exists nowhere else
Own the look. AI-generated visuals carry no third-party footage claims and can't be mass-matched by rights holders, the same footage-free logic that keeps sports and news-adjacent channels copyright-safe
Spend renders where they show. Full text-to-video clips (Sora-class) are expensive per second; a practical mix is AI images with motion for 80% of scenes and true generated clips for the two moments that carry the video

Mixing AI Assets with Real Footage: The Hybrid Workflow
Yes, you can combine AI-generated assets with real footage, and hybrid channels often out-perform pure-AI ones because reality anchors trust while AI supplies scale. Three proven patterns:
Real core, AI wrap: your genuine footage (gameplay, screen recordings, product shots) as the base layer, with AI voiceover, captions, and generated intro/outro scenes around it
AI core, real proof: an AI-visual story or explainer that cuts to one real clip, a screenshot, a location shot, a receipt, at the moment credibility matters most
Real A-roll, AI B-roll: talking content or podcast audio illustrated by generated scenes instead of stock, the podcast-clip upgrade almost nobody does yet
One rule keeps hybrids clean: match the grade. Push both layers toward one color treatment so the seam between real and generated disappears, mismatched color is what makes hybrids feel stitched together.

Use Case #1–#5: The Five Highest-Performing Faceless Formats
Use Case #1: Reddit story videos. Adapt (never verbatim-read) a story into a 140-word script with the twist re-engineered for the final beat; pair with gameplay or AI-scene visuals. Use Case #2: Ranking and Top 5 videos. Countdown structure is built-in retention, viewers stay for #1. Keep each entry to two lines, tease the top spot in the hook, and let a template handle the visual scaffolding. ▶ Walkthrough: https://www.youtube.com/watch?v=8LrvxzznZUY
Use Case #3: Text-message story videos. Fake-text conversations dramatize the same narrative pull as Reddit stories in a native phone-screen visual. Use Case #4: Instructional and explainer videos. Yes, you can create these entirely with AI, script the steps, one visual per step, calm authoritative voice, numbered captions. The 60-second constraint is a feature: it forces the tutorial to its essence, and clear step-content earns saves and shares, which platforms weight heavily.
Use Case #5: Motivational shorts. The easiest format to make and the hardest to differentiate. Original lines beat recycled quotes (originality policies now punish verbatim recycling), one strong metaphor beats five clichés, and a distinctive visual style is the entire moat.

How to Produce Videos Faster Than Competitors: Batching and Templates
Speed compounds in faceless content because cadence, not any single video, grows channels. The production system that outruns competitors:
Batch by stage, not by video. Write seven scripts, then generate seven videos, then review seven. Staying in one mode cuts total time by a third versus producing one video end-to-end at a time
Template everything decided. Visual style, caption design, voice, structure, pre-made templates mean each new video only asks for its script
Reuse research. One good source session (stories gathered, facts checked) feeds a week of scripts; per-video research is the hidden time sink
Track two speed numbers. Minutes per published video, and videos per week, if the first stalls, fix templates; if the second stalls, fix scheduling
Protect the judgment pass. The review step is the one stage never to automate away, it's your quality moat and your policy compliance in one
A solo creator running this system sustainably produces 7–15 shorts a week in a few hours, volume that used to require an editor on payroll.
FAQs
How long should my script be for a 60-second Short?
130–160 words at natural narration pace (roughly 140–150 words per minute). Write to 140, and if the story needs more, cut context rather than speeding the voice, accelerated narration is the most common tell of a rushed AI short. For TikTok monetization, remember qualifying videos need 60+ seconds, so script to just over the minute there.
Do I need to clone my own voice, and how does it work?
You don't need to, stock AI voices are fine to start, but a custom voice is the strongest consistency asset a faceless channel can own. You record a few minutes of clean audio once, the tool builds a synthetic version, and every future script renders in it. Clone only your own voice or licensed voices; cloning real people without permission triggers disclosure rules and takedowns.
Can I edit the video after AI generates it?
Yes, and you should, the professional workflow is generate, then adjust: swap a weak scene, re-time a caption, trim a slow beat. Good tools make per-scene edits native so you're refining, not re-rendering. Budget five minutes of editing per video; publishing unreviewed output is how channels drift into template sameness.
Can I make versions in multiple languages?
Yes, modern caption systems support 100+ languages, and voiceover can be regenerated per language from the same script. The efficient pattern: validate a video's performance in your primary language first, then localize only proven winners rather than translating everything by default.
Should I make vertical or horizontal videos?
Vertical 9:16 for Shorts, TikTok, and Reels, full stop. Produce horizontal only if you're also feeding a long-form channel. If you need both, generate vertical as the master and adapt, because vertical framing survives cropping decisions that horizontal doesn't.
How do I fix bad or weird AI visuals?
Per scene, not per video: regenerate the offending image with a more concrete prompt (add nouns, lighting, and your style block), or swap in a template graphic for that beat. If the same weirdness recurs, mangled hands, warped text, stop prompting for what the model draws badly and reframe the scene to avoid it. Never ship a broken visual on the hook; the first two seconds are where weirdness costs you the viewer.
